Are you gearing up for an interview for a Database Designer position? Whether you’re a seasoned professional or just stepping into the role, understanding what’s expected can make all the difference. In this blog, we dive deep into the essential interview questions for Database Designer and break down the key responsibilities of the role. By exploring these insights, you’ll gain a clearer picture of what employers are looking for and how you can stand out. Read on to equip yourself with the knowledge and confidence needed to ace your next interview and land your dream job!
Acing the interview is crucial, but landing one requires a compelling resume that gets you noticed. Crafting a professional document that highlights your skills and experience is the first step toward interview success. ResumeGemini can help you build a standout resume that gets you called in for that dream job.
Essential Interview Questions For Database Designer
1. Explain the process of designing a database schema?
- Gather requirements from stakeholders
- Create a conceptual data model
- Translate the conceptual data model into a logical data model
- Create a physical data model
- Implement the database schema
- Test the database schema
- Deploy the database schema
2. What are the different types of database schemas?
- Star schema
- Snowflake schema
- Bus schema
- Inmon schema
- Kimball schema
3. What are the different types of database normalization?
- First normal form (1NF)
- Second normal form (2NF)
- Third normal form (3NF)
- Boyce-Codd normal form (BCNF)
- Fourth normal form (4NF)
- Fifth normal form (5NF)
4. What are the different types of database indexes?
- Clustered index
- Non-clustered index
- Unique index
- Full-text index
- Spatial index
5. What are the different types of database constraints?
- Primary key constraint
- Foreign key constraint
- Unique constraint
- Check constraint
- Default constraint
6. What are the different types of database triggers?
- Insert trigger
- Update trigger
- Delete trigger
- Instead of insert trigger
- Instead of update trigger
- Instead of delete trigger
7. What are the different types of database stored procedures?
- User-defined functions (UDFs)
- User-defined stored procedures (UDPs)
- User-defined table types (UDTTs)
- User-defined aggregate functions (UDAFs)
- User-defined scalar functions (UDSFs)
8. What are the different types of database views?
- Materialized views
- Indexed views
- Partitioned views
- Updatable views
- Non-updatable views
9. What are the different types of database security?
- Authentication
- Authorization
- Data encryption
- Data masking
- Data auditing
10. What are the different types of database performance tuning?
- Query optimization
- Index optimization
- Table partitioning
- Database replication
- Hardware optimization
Interviewers often ask about specific skills and experiences. With ResumeGemini‘s customizable templates, you can tailor your resume to showcase the skills most relevant to the position, making a powerful first impression. Also check out Resume Template specially tailored for Database Designer.
Career Expert Tips:
- Ace those interviews! Prepare effectively by reviewing the Top 50 Most Common Interview Questions on ResumeGemini.
- Navigate your job search with confidence! Explore a wide range of Career Tips on ResumeGemini. Learn about common challenges and recommendations to overcome them.
- Craft the perfect resume! Master the Art of Resume Writing with ResumeGemini’s guide. Showcase your unique qualifications and achievements effectively.
- Great Savings With New Year Deals and Discounts! In 2025, boost your job search and build your dream resume with ResumeGemini’s ATS optimized templates.
Researching the company and tailoring your answers is essential. Once you have a clear understanding of the Database Designer‘s requirements, you can use ResumeGemini to adjust your resume to perfectly match the job description.
Key Job Responsibilities
Database Designers are responsible for designing, implementing, and maintaining databases. They work closely with other IT professionals to ensure that the database meets the needs of the organization. Some of the key job responsibilities of a Database Designer include:
1. Design and develop database schemas
Database Designers are responsible for creating the logical and physical structures of databases. They must have a strong understanding of data modeling and database design principles to ensure that the database is efficient, scalable, and secure.
2. Implement and maintain databases
Once the database schema has been designed, Database Designers are responsible for implementing and maintaining the database. This includes setting up the database on a server, creating user accounts, and granting permissions. Database Designers must also monitor the database for performance issues and make necessary adjustments.
3. Work with other IT professionals
Database Designers often work with other IT professionals, such as developers, system administrators, and business analysts. They must be able to communicate effectively with these other professionals to ensure that the database meets the needs of the organization.
4. Stay up-to-date on the latest database technologies
Database technology is constantly changing, so Database Designers must stay up-to-date on the latest trends. This includes attending conferences, reading technical articles, and taking training courses.
Interview Tips
Preparing for a Database Designer interview can be daunting, but there are a few things you can do to increase your chances of success. Here are a few tips:
1. Research the company and the position
Before you go on an interview, it’s important to do your research on the company and the position. This will help you to understand the company’s culture and the specific requirements of the job. You can find this information on the company’s website, in industry publications, or by talking to people who work at the company.
2. Practice your answers to common interview questions
There are a number of common interview questions that you are likely to be asked, such as “Why are you interested in this position?” and “What are your strengths and weaknesses?” It’s a good idea to practice your answers to these questions in advance so that you can deliver them confidently and concisely.
3. Be prepared to talk about your experience
The interviewer will want to know about your experience in database design and development. Be prepared to talk about your projects, your skills, and your accomplishments. You should also be able to discuss your knowledge of database technologies and your experience with different database management systems.
4. Ask questions
Asking questions at the end of the interview shows that you are interested in the position and that you are serious about your career. It also gives you an opportunity to learn more about the company and the position. Some good questions to ask include: “What are the biggest challenges facing the database team?” and “What are the opportunities for professional development?”
Next Step:
Now that you’re armed with interview-winning answers and a deeper understanding of the Database Designer role, it’s time to take action! Does your resume accurately reflect your skills and experience for this position? If not, head over to ResumeGemini. Here, you’ll find all the tools and tips to craft a resume that gets noticed. Don’t let a weak resume hold you back from landing your dream job. Polish your resume, hit the “Build Your Resume” button, and watch your career take off! Remember, preparation is key, and ResumeGemini is your partner in interview success.
